. Human resources are the most important asset of an organisation and their effective management is the key to its success.
2. This success is most likely to be achieved if the personnel policies and procedures of the enterprise are closely linked with, and make a major contribution to the achievement of corporate objectives and strategic plans.
3. The corporate culture and the values, organisational climate and managerial behaviour that emanate from that culture will exert a major influence on the achievement of excellence.
4. HRM is concerned with integration – getting all the members of the organisation involved and working together with a sense of common purpose
